WebChemical potential energy is a form of potential energy related to the structural arrangement of atoms or molecules. This arrangement may be the result of chemical bonds within a molecule or interactions between them. Chemical energy of a chemical substance can be transformed to other forms of energy by a chemical reaction. WebMar 24, 2024 · According to the above equation, you generate 852 kJ of energy for every 2 moles of Fe that are formed. So, we can calculate moles of Fe equivalent to 98.7 g, and then find the energy liberated. moles of Fe formed = 98.7 g x 1 mole/55.85 g = 1.77 moles Fe.
